Output d43f5d105b3720819ab13cd6fbc2e0f3348c7f264c4ad28bbd5a42e2e8f53506:0

value
1143900
script pubkey
OP_0 OP_PUSHBYTES_20 3c58bc6fb49f8f811a514f36bfceac3d7ec55a41
address
bc1q83vtcma5n78czxj3fumtln4v84lv2kjpx4wnv8
transaction
d43f5d105b3720819ab13cd6fbc2e0f3348c7f264c4ad28bbd5a42e2e8f53506
confirmations
347455
spent
true